The Penobscot County Triad is an organization of law enforcement, social service agencies and senior citizens working together to protect and educate seniors about fraud and crime.
Rosscare in Bangor provides "Telecare" which provides free telephone contact for any individual who lives alone in the greater Bangor area. Every Monday-Friday between 8am-930am volunteers call area seniors to ensure they are safe. There is no age requirement. Call Rosscare at 973-7094 to sign up.

Gateway Seniors Without Walls is a 501(c) (3) organization, staffed by volunteers, and strives to serve the needs of seniors in Orono, Old Town, Veazie, and surrounding communities. Our mission is to sponsor quality daily activities and to publicize services in order to supplement and extend the resources that are currently available to older people within our community. Ultimately, we hope that our programs will improve quality of life for seniors and keep them active, healthy, and aging in place within the community. Although seniors are our primary focus, people of all ages are welcome to participate in our programs.
